The Science Behind Compression Deepness and Rate in CPR
Before diving into the specifics of compression depth and price, it's essential to comprehend what they entail. Compression depth refers to exactly how far you push down on the breast during compressions, while compression rate is about exactly how quickly you deliver these compressions. Both elements are vital for ensuring efficient blood flow throughout cardiac arrest.
Why Is Compression Depth Important?
Research suggests that sufficient compression depth-- in between 2 to 2.4 inches for adults-- is crucial for optimum blood circulation. Compressions that are as well superficial may not efficiently flow blood to important body organs.
What Concerning Compression Rate?
The recommended compression rate is between 100 to 120 compressions per min. A slow-moving compression rate can lead to insufficient blood circulation, which can lower the opportunities of survival.
In essence, both compression depth and rate play an essential role in maintaining appropriate perfusion stress-- also prior to specialist help arrives.

Taking Turns on Compressions: Ideal Practices
When several -responders exist:
- Switch every 2 mins or after 5 cycles of compressions. This practice reduces fatigue and preserves top notch compressions.

FAQ Section
1. What is the suitable compression deepness for adults during CPR?
The excellent compression deepness for grownups ranges from 2 inches (5 cm) approximately regarding 2.4 inches (6 centimeters).
2. Exactly how quick should I perform upper body compressions?
Chest compressions should be supplied at a rate between 100 to 120 compressions per minute.
